Entry requirements
Mechanical Engineering BA (B), Materials Engineering, 6 credits; Mechanical Engineering BA (C), Continuum Mechanics, 9 credits; Industrial Design BA (C), Interaction Design, 6 credits, Industrial Design Engineering BA (C), Computer Aided Modelling, 9 credits; and Industrial Design Engineering BA (C), Thesis Project, 15 credits.

Examination form
I100: Ergonomics, Assignment Report, 3 Credits
Grade scale: Fail (U) or Pass (G)
I700: Project, Written Assignment, 2 Credits
Grade scale: Fail (U), Pass (G), or Pass with distinction (VG)
L300: Optimization, Laboration Work, 1.5 Credits
Grade scale: Fail (U) or Pass (G)
P700: Project, Oral Presentation, 1 Credits
Grade scale: Fail (U) or Pass (G)
Q500: Technical Drawing, Exam, 1.5 Credits
Grade scale: Fail (U) or Pass (G)
R700: Project, Report, 6 Credits
Grade scale: Seven-grade scale, A, B, C, D, E, Fx and F. Fx and F represent fail levels.
T100: Ergonomics, Exam, 1.5 Credits
Grade scale: Fail (U) or Pass (G)
T200: Manufacturing Technology, Exam, 3 Credits
Grade scale: Seven-grade scale, A, B, C, D, E, Fx and F. Fx and F represent fail levels.
T300: Optimization, Exam, 3 Credits
Grade scale: Seven-grade scale, A, B, C, D, E, Fx and F. Fx and F represent fail levels.
T400: Life Cycle Assessment, Exam, 3 Credits
Grade scale: Fail (U) or Pass (G)
T600: Solid Mechanics, Exam, 4.5 Credits
Grade scale: Seven-grade scale, A, B, C, D, E, Fx and F. Fx and F represent fail levels.
